Output 56608386c869f27f57ad3cd8ef8b97b57f53a4a3429fe8ce3889b6d1a51efda8:0

value
43747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b0b057081b8295314d75917ccc91cca0287d95 OP_EQUAL
address
3PYP5wqKj7Uq1Pa9a59FMpGjMQLbYaz3Yd
transaction
56608386c869f27f57ad3cd8ef8b97b57f53a4a3429fe8ce3889b6d1a51efda8
spent
true